c++ - C++ 中是否有等效的 str_replace?

标签 c++ replace

在 PHP 中,有一个 str_replace基本上执行查找和替换的功能。在 C++ 中是否有此函数的等效项?

最佳答案

不完全是,但看看 Boost String Algorithms Library - 在本例中为 replace functions :

std::string str("aabbaadd");    
boost::algorithm::replace_all(str, "aa", "xx");

str 现在包含 "xxbbxxdd"

关于c++ - C++ 中是否有等效的 str_replace?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3081505/

相关文章:

c++ - OpenCV 是否为 cv::Point 提供平方范数函数?

c++ - 如何在 Qt 应用程序中通过终端命令运行分离的应用程序?

c++ - 如何在exe文件夹中不包含纹理

python - 根据 NaN 将列值替换为 0 或 1

iphone - 如何在 iphone 的 NSString 中删除 ("") 双引号字符?

c++ - 我需要帮助在 C++ 中创建优先级队列

c++ - 如何在C++上读取多个文件

javascript - js字符串替换不起作用

c# - 查找并替换所有以 # 开头的单词,并将带标签的文本包装在 HTML 中

javascript - 正则表达式中出现意外的标记错误